It seems to me that the article proves that Wash *did* die - it concludes that the force of the spear would have been significantly greater than the force of a "hypervelocity bullet" like the paint fleck in space. To a degree that unless the windows on Serenity were considerably more durable than assumed minimum safety standards the spear probably would have split Wash in half and lodged itself in the back of the cockpit rather than just impaled him.
But maybe I'm reading that wrong. I admit the math goes a bit over my head at this time of morning, but the author uses words like "unfortunately" and "Wash didn't stand a chance".

I read that last week. The math is screwed up, although I noticed an update at the bottom that brings it closer to being correct. Never trust physics analyses in Wired (SciAm republished Wired), because I've yet to see them do one without major errors. The ones from Wolfram Alpha tend to be better. (WA did Baumgardener's jump.) And yes, even with their revision Wired concluded Wash died.
